### Step 2: Tame the spreadsheet exporter

Welcome aboard! The Gridwhale exporter used to load whole workbooks into memory, which blew up on big tenants. We now stream rows in chunks, so you'll need to update the worker settings before deploying. Set the streaming values for the export worker as listed here.

settings of fafog-haduf:
ZORIX_PIN=4648
ZORIX_METRICS_HOST=metrics.zorix.paliqsys.corp
ZORIX_LOG_LEVEL=info
ZORIX_TENANT=druix

14:22 — Digest scheduler on Pellworth started double-sending the morning batch. Turns out the cron shim and the new Tideline scheduler were both live after the migration flag got flipped early. Reviewer heads-up: the dedupe guard you'll see in this diff is the fix, not gold-plating. We disabled the shim at 14:41 and re-queued skipped digests. The deploy that introduced the overlap is identified by the token immediately below.

trace token, fafog-kageg: htk4_98e6

### Meeting notes — Brickline migration (excerpt)

Context for new folks: we're moving the Ottervale monorepo build onto Brickline, our hermetic build system. No network access during builds. All deps pinned.

- Phase 1 done: core libs build hermetically.
- Phase 2 blocked: codegen step still fetches templates at build time. Fix in review.
- Phase 3: CI cutover, target next sprint.

Don't add unpinned deps. Any exception needs written approval. Escalations and exception requests go to the migration owner, named below.

named custodian: Brivan Eliath Quenox Frador